Title: The Reel God of CineFreakNet
Logline: In the chaotic underbelly of India’s most狂热 film forum, a mysterious user known only as “The Great Indian Ka Hot” triggers a digital rebellion — by reviewing movies before they even exist.
Arjun “AJ” Mehta had three addictions: cutting chai, conspiracy theories, and CineFreakNet — the wildest, most ungovernable movie discussion board on the desi internet. CFN, as regulars called it, was a swamp of fan wars, nepotism debates, and deep-fried SRK memes. But AJ loved it. His handle was Bollywood_Buddha, and his 6 a.m. “Chai & Cinema” threads were legendary.
Then came The Great Indian Ka Hot.
Nobody knew who they were. The profile picture was a grainy screengrab of Hrithik Roshan’s Dhoom 2 flip. The bio read: “I am the projectionist of your dreams.” And then they posted.
First post:
“Animal 2 ki climax leak — not the one Vanga shot. The one he dreamt. Anil Kapoor as a werewolf. Trust me.”
CFN laughed. Banter followed. Then, three months later, leaked BTS photos from Animal 2 showed Anil Kapoor in mo-cap dots. The internet lost its mind.
Second post:
“Dunki 2 ka real title: Dunki: No Entry. Shah Rukh plays a ghost border-runner. Watch the funeral scene in the first ten minutes.”
CFN called it a fluke. But a junior writer from Red Chillies later tweeted (then deleted): “Someone on CFN guessed the entire third act. We’re freaking out.”
The Great Indian Ka Hot became a deity. Their predictions weren’t reviews — they were scriptures. Fans began decoding every word. “Ka Hot” — was it a typo? Or “Kā Hōt” — Sanskrit for “what burns”? CFN lore ran wild.
AJ, however, smelled a rat. Or rather, a star.
He traced the IPs — not to a studio, not to a leaker, but to a single flat in Goregaon East. The same building where a faded poster of Mughal-e-Azam hung outside a locked door.
Inside, AJ found not a hacker or a director, but a 74-year-old retired focus puller named Shankar Iyengar. He had worked on 400 films. He could no longer walk. But every night, he watched rushes — not on screens, but in his head.
“Beta,” Shankar said, pouring AJ chai, “I’ve held the camera for Dilip Kumar. I’ve seen Rajinikanth smoke a cigarette in one take. I know every actor’s tic, every producer’s greed, every script’s corpse buried under a ‘happy ending.’ I don’t leak films. I leak the truth of what they will become.”
“But how do you know the future?” AJ whispered.
Shankar smiled. “Because Bollywood has only made three stories since 1951. I just watch which one they’re pretending to tell today.”
AJ’s next thread went viral: “The Great Indian Ka Hot is not a prophet. He’s a memory.”

But Shankar typed one last post, hands trembling over a cracked keyboard:
“The greatest Indian film hasn’t been made yet. It’s in the seat behind the man who checks his phone during the song. It’s in the little girl watching Mohabbatein on a train and believing love is real. You are not an audience. You are the rushes. Cut to: your life.”
Then he deleted his account.
CineFreakNet mourned for a week. Then returned to its usual chaos — catfights over nepotism, lists of “most underrated Govinda comedies,” and a new user named Retired_Ka_Hot who only ever posted one thing:
“Interval time. Be back in 15.”
And somewhere in Goregaon East, Shankar Iyengar closed his eyes, smiled, and watched the next perfect movie — the one nobody had dared to make yet.
End credit roll: Dedicated to every projectionist who saw the film before the lights went down.
